**Company Description**

Publicis Media helps clients drive sustainable business growth by harnessing the modern media landscape to drive one-to-one consumer connections at scale. Led by Sue Frogley, CEO, Publicis Media UK is made up of 2000 people working across market-leadingmedia agencies including Zenith, Starcom and Spark Foundry as well as specialist practices Publicis Media Exchange (PMX), Performics, Publicis Sport & Entertainment, Publicis Media Content and NextTECHnow. Together they combine deep expertise in media investment,strategy, insights and analytics, data and technology, commerce, performance marketing and content. Publicis Media is part of Publicis Groupe and is present in more than 100 countries with over 23,500 employees worldwide.

As a Talent Advisor at Publicis Media you’ll work closely with the Senior Talent Partner supporting with the relevant departments and management teams. Responsibilities will vary according to the needs of the business but include dealing with Employee Relationsissues and helping to deliver engagement initiatives.

We are looking for a bright, articulate and motivated person to join the Publicis Media UK Talent team. Someone with the confidence to run their own meetings with stakeholders across the business and trust their judgement on the relevant HR process to followas well as proactive and keen to support the delivery of effective people initiatives.

If you have been an HR Administrator, Assistant or Advisor but have outgrown your current role and want to have your own ER casework and get involved in projects this could be perfect for you.

**Responsibilities**:

- Support Talent Partners in delivering the talent plans. Building effective relationships with employees and managers across a number of different departments
- Develop coaching relationships with managers to build their capability in managing people
- Responsible for managing and tracking ER issues such as disciplinary, grievance, sickness and PIPs. Providing advice and training to managers, ensuring legislation is followed and liaising with the Talent Partners where necessary
- Support Talent Partners with organizational restructures and any TUPE processes, redundancies.
- Proactively support the consistent approach to performance management, including providing training on process and tools, coaching and support to managers and ensuring standards are achieved across all departments
- Contribute to Talent initiatives and change projects as directed by Talent Partners, working collaboratively with the team to deliver to deadlines
- Work with managers to ensure everyone attends induction, probation objectives are being set and reviewed. Carrying out entrance interviews and analyzing new joiner feedback.
- Conduct effective exit interviews, feedback the information required and highlight any concerns to Talent Partners and present quarterly analysis
- Regularly attend department meetings to keep up to date with business context and changing industry
- Support the coordination of salary reviews, collaborating with the Talent Partners and Talent Operations team to ensure current data is up to date and conducting benchmarking exercises. Supporting with communication around salary review process.
- Work with Talent Partners to help with planning training events, ensure good attendance and follow up where relevant. Manage conversations around ad hoc training requests
- Help gather data for reporting purposes (e.g. absence, diversity, turnover) working with Talent Operations team. Understand what the data means and how to use it

**Qualifications**
- Excellent employment law knowledge
- Experience in working effectively in a changing and fast-paced environment with flexible approach
- Demonstrate continuous personal and professional development
- Previous experience in similar industry preferred but not essential
- Experience in gathering and analyzing employee data
- Immediate to advance experience in Excel and PowerPoint
